Overview

**Eukaryotic translation elongation factor 1 gamma pseudogene 3 (EEF1GP3)** is a predicted processed pseudogene related to the gene encoding eukaryotic translation elongation factor 1 gamma (EEF1G)[1][3][5]. EEF1G is a structural and regulatory subunit of the eukaryotic translation elongation factor 1 complex, which is involved in protein synthesis, but EEF1GP3 itself is not protein-coding and is not considered a functional gene or therapeutic target[1][3]. According to genome sequence analyses, EEF1GP3 is predicted by computational methods and is not supported by experimental evidence for any protein- or RNA-coding function currently[1]. There is no direct information on biological functions, disease roles, drug interactions, or clinical utility for EEF1GP3.\n\n**Key details and context:**\n- EEF1GP3 is classified as a pseudogene, meaning it is a DNA sequence related to a gene but typically non-functional due to mutations or lack of regulatory elements necessary for expression[1][3][5].\n- Unlike some other pseudogenes which may be transcribed into non-coding RNAs with potential regulatory functions, EEF1GP3 is only predicted computationally and is not experimentally validated to show any expression or function[1].\n- Pseudogenes of the EEF1G family, including EEF1GP3, are not considered therapeutic targets or druggable entities[1].\n- EEF1G (the functional gene) is part of the elongation factor 1 complex involved in translational elongation in eukaryotes, but there is no evidence that its pseudogenes, such as EEF1GP3, participate in these or other biological functions[1][2][4].\n- There are no known interacting drugs, mechanisms of action, biomarker roles, or safety concerns for EEF1GP3.\n\n**Additional notes:**\n- EEF1GP3 should not be confused with EEF1G, the functional gene.\n- Because it is a predicted pseudogene with no known transcription or function, EEF1GP3 is not considered a \"target\" in drug discovery or molecular medicine[1][3][5].
